Netkerfisstýrikerfi is an Icelandic term for software systems that manage and control a network’s fabric resources. It coordinates devices such as switches and routers, enforces policies, and provides automation and telemetry across the network. Such systems are commonly used in data centers, service provider networks, and large campuses to improve operational efficiency and agility.
